Abstract

When a body is exposed to the natural environment, there are a multitude of taphonomic agents that can affect the remains. One taphonomic agent that has not been extensively studied in Canada is vertebrate scavengers. Although in recent years vertebrate scavenging studies have occurred in several provinces, Canada is a large country with many environmental and climate types. This study aimed to determine the scavenger guild of a rural region of Leamington, in southwestern Ontario. Pig carcasses were surface deposited at a secure location which was accessible to scavengers with placement of two carcasses each in Fall 2023 and Summer 2024, respectively. Scavenging activity was captured using cellular and non-cellular trail cameras. Images were qualitatively analyzed to establish species interaction with the carcasses. It was found that the number of species was limited, but the presence of certain species was prevalent. At all sites, opossums and coyotes were the most frequent scavengers, with coyotes being responsible for the movement and dispersal of the carcasses. The study findings can provide valuable information when searching for human remains in this area or in other areas with similar terrain, climate and species.
